Can I completely restyle my calendar using CSS? It looks like I can only change colors, but I want custom fonts, sizes, etc.

In addition to the customization options under Options->Colors, the following CSS is exposed/intended to be used by members for customization of their calendar:

.m-usr
.mt-usr
.mm-usr
.mal-usr
.mar-usr
.w-usr
.wt-usr
.wal-usr
.war-usr
.d-usr
.dt-usr
.dal-usr
.dar-usr


You can view the calendar source for the day, week, and month views to see where these classes are applied. That will allow you to change fonts on the calendar events, titles, etc.

The Options->Colors editor lets you change a lot of the colors on your calendar, but there are things it doesn't let you do like change font sizes, opacities, more specific background effects/images, etc.

That's why we added the custom CSS "hooks" mentioned in the post above. These are for experienced webmasters to create their own stylesheets to enhance their calendars. Most people who go this route then put the HTML to include their custom stylesheets in their calendar's Title field under Options->General.
